1942807F37Paris: P. M. Le Blanc 1942. Leather. Near Fine. 11.5" by 9.5". Guy Arnoux. A beautifully bound and vibrantly illustrated Limited Edition of this historical novel set in the sixteenth century French court illustrated with colour lithographs from Guy Arnoux. In the original French.A vibrantly illustrated Limited Edition of French Romantic writer Prosper Merimee's historical novel set in the French court in the mid sixteenth century at the time of the St. Bartholomew massacre.Beautifully bound in half crushed morocco and with publisher's original paper wraps and back strip bound in to the front and rear of the work. Of only 410 copies produced this volume is no. 152 one of 125 copies printed with a suite of fifteen plates in black and white to the rear.Illustrated with fifteen colour lithograph plates by French artist Guy Arnoux alongside the further fifteen plates to the rear. Collated complete.Best known for the novella 'Carmen' this is a stunning edition of Merimee's historical novel first published in 1828. In a half crushed morocco binding with marbled paper covered boards. Minor fading to back strip. Otherwise externally fine. The odd spot to fore edge of text block. With publisher's original paper wraps and back strip bound in to the front and rear of the work. Internally firmly bound. Pages bright and generally clean with the odd area of more significant spotting to page perimeters towards centre of text block. Near Fine P. M. Le Blanc hardcover

1897863F21Paris: Calmann Levy 1897 . Leather. Very Good. 8.5" by 6.5". Gaston Vuillier. A very smart illustrated edition of Prosper Merimee's thrilling novella about a deadly vendetta. In the original French. Illustrated throughout by French artist Gaston Vuillier.Merimee's novel follows the tale of a young Corsican girl who pushes her brother to kill in order to avenge their father's murder.It was adapted into a film 'Vendetta' in 1950 produced by Howard Hughes.With the bookplate of Alfred Nathaniel Holden Curzon 4th Baron Curzon and his wife Blanche to the front pastedown. An inscription to a front endpaper is addressed to Alfred dated 1909 signed H.I.E. In a quarter morocco binding with marbled paper covered boards. Externally very smart with light rubbing to board perimeters and joints. Bookplate to front pastedown with inscription to a front blank. Internally firmly bound. Pages lightly age toned but clean and bright. Very Good Calmann Levy hardcover
